Transaction ebcafb5b76081690166b845408eeb3772c7fbabe6cbc162b40de3634d9f6aec4
1 Input
1 Output
-
ebcafb5b76081690166b845408eeb3772c7fbabe6cbc162b40de3634d9f6aec4:0
- value
- 461740
- script pubkey
- OP_0 OP_PUSHBYTES_20 745c8c5002fd392c2c84ce4d80e3160238562bbc
- address
- bc1qw3wgc5qzl5ujctyyeexcpcckqgu9v2auuk7zns